Released in 1928, The Phantom of the Range is a western film directed by James Dugan, running about 63 minutes.

What it’s about. Duke Carlton, an actor stranded in a small western town, gets a job as a cowboy on Tim O'Brien's ranch as a reward for beating up "Flash" Corbin, a real estate agent who has been trying to swindle the rancher. A romance develops between the actor and Patsy O'Brien, the rancher's daughter, but it is interrupted by the appearance of his former stage partner, Vera Van Swank, who claims him as her husband. He clears himself of the bigamy charge, foils a plot to cheat the rancher out of a $90,000 land property, and wins the daughter's hand.

Who’s in it. The Phantom of the Range stars Tom Tyler as Duke Carlton, Charles McHugh as Tim O'Brien, Duane Thompson as Patsy O'Brien and Frankie Darro as Spuds O'Brien, among others.
